One technology that has been gaining popularity in recent years is p25 digital, also known as Project 25.

p25 digital is a suite of standards for digital two-way radio communication systems used by federal, state, local, and tribal public safety agencies around the world. It was developed collaboratively by the Association of Public-Safety Communications Officials (APCO), the National Association of State Telecommunications Directors (NASTD), and the National Telecommunications and Information Administration (NTIA) in response to the need for interoperable radio communication systems.

Interoperability is the ability of different systems or components to work together seamlessly, regardless of the manufacturer or technology used. Prior to the development of p25 digital, many public safety agencies used proprietary radio systems that were not compatible with each other. This lack of interoperability hindered communication during emergencies and large-scale incidents when agencies needed to work together.

With P25 digital, agencies can now communicate with each other using a common set of standards and protocols, ensuring interoperability and seamless coordination during critical incidents. P25 digital radios are also backward compatible with legacy analog systems, allowing agencies to transition to digital technology at their own pace without sacrificing interoperability with neighboring agencies.

One of the key advantages of P25 digital is its improved audio quality and clarity compared to analog systems. Digital technology eliminates the background noise and interference common in analog systems, resulting in clear, crisp audio that is essential for effective communication in noisy environments or during emergencies.

Another advantage of P25 digital is its enhanced security features. Digital encryption capabilities allow agencies to secure their communications and prevent unauthorized listeners from eavesdropping on sensitive information. This is especially important for public safety agencies that handle sensitive information and need to protect the privacy of individuals during emergencies.

In addition to interoperability, audio quality, and security, P25 digital also offers advanced features such as text messaging, GPS location tracking, and dispatch console integration. These features enhance the efficiency and effectiveness of communication systems, allowing agencies to communicate more effectively and make quicker decisions during emergencies.

Despite its many advantages, transitioning to P25 digital can be a complex and costly process for public safety agencies. The cost of upgrading existing infrastructure, purchasing new radios, and training personnel on the new technology can be significant. However, the long-term benefits of improved interoperability, audio quality, and security often outweigh the initial costs.

To support agencies in transitioning to P25 digital, the federal government has allocated funding through grant programs such as the Homeland Security Grant Program (HSGP) and the Assistance to Firefighters Grants (AFG) Program. These grants provide financial assistance to public safety agencies for the purchase of P25 digital radios and infrastructure upgrades, helping to accelerate the adoption of digital technology across the country.
